在Angular TypeScript中使用Timetable.js,您可以按照以下步骤进行操作:
- 安装Timetable.js:在Angular项目的根目录下,打开终端并运行以下命令来安装Timetable.js依赖:npm install timetablejs
- 导入Timetable.js:在需要使用Timetable.js的组件中,通过import语句导入Timetable.js库:import * as Timetable from 'timetablejs';
- 创建Timetable实例:在组件的逻辑部分,创建一个Timetable实例,并根据需要配置其属性和事件:const timetable = new Timetable();
timetable.setScope(9, 18); // 设置时间范围
timetable.addLocations(['会议室A', '会议室B', '会议室C']); // 添加会议室位置
- 添加事件:使用addEvent方法向Timetable实例中添加事件:timetable.addEvent('会议', '会议室A', new Date(2022, 1, 1, 10, 0), new Date(2022, 1, 1, 12, 0));
- 渲染Timetable:在组件的HTML模板中,使用Timetable实例的render方法来渲染Timetable:<div id="timetable"></div>
const container = document.getElementById('timetable');
timetable.render(container);
这样,您就可以在Angular TypeScript中成功使用Timetable.js来展示和管理事件日程了。
Timetable.js是一个用于创建和管理时间表的JavaScript库。它提供了一组简单易用的API,可以帮助您在网页或应用中展示各种类型的事件日程。Timetable.js的优势包括易于集成、灵活性高、支持自定义样式和事件等。
Timetable.js适用于各种场景,例如会议室预订、课程表管理、活动安排等。通过使用Timetable.js,您可以轻松地创建交互式的时间表,并根据需要进行自定义。
腾讯云提供了一系列与云计算相关的产品和服务,其中包括云服务器、云数据库、云存储等。您可以根据具体需求选择适合的腾讯云产品来支持您的应用开发和部署。更多关于腾讯云产品的信息,请访问腾讯云官方网站:腾讯云。